“Blinding Lights” by The Weeknd (Canada, b. Abel Tesfaye) is the most streamed track on Spotify. As of 24 February 2024, the chart-topping hit from 2019 was the only track to have exceeded four billion streams (4,084,773,127) on the platform.


“Blinding Lights” was the second single to be released from The Weeknd’s fourth studio album, After Hours (2020).

The top 10 most streamed songs on Spotify, as of 24 February 2024, were: “Blinding Lights” (The Weeknd, 2019): 4,084,773,127; “Shape of You” (Ed Sheeran, 2017): 3,793,746,246; “Someone You Loved” (Lewis Capaldi, 2018): 3,232,584,366; “Sunflower” (Post Malone feat. Swae Lee, 2018): 3,175,425,321; “Starboy” (The Weeknd, 2016): 3,059,336,917; “As It Was” (Harry Styles, 2022): 3,041,420,452; “One Dance” (Drake, 2016): 3,009,417,329; “Dance Monkey” (Tones and I, 2019): 2,998,094,263; “STAY” (The Kid LAROI with Justin Bieber, 2021): 2,963,466,116; “rockstar” (Post Malone feat. 21 Savage, 2017): 2,883,760,911.
